Pros and cons

v0.dev

Teams and individuals who need frontend developers prototyping ui quickly.

Strengths

  • Generates production-ready React and Next.js code
  • Visual editor for real-time component preview and editing
  • Integrated with Vercel for one-click deployment
  • Can generate full pages, not just isolated components
  • Free tier available for testing and learning

Weaknesses

  • Generated code quality varies; often needs refinement
  • Limited customization of design system and brand guidelines
  • API not available for programmatic integration

Galileo AI

Teams and individuals who need product designers creating wireframes and mockups quickly from briefs.

Strengths

  • Generates complete UI screens with proper hierarchy and spacing
  • Outputs editable Figma components for immediate customization
  • Reduces mockup creation time from hours to minutes
  • Maintains design consistency through pre-built component libraries
  • Free tier available without requiring payment card

Weaknesses

  • Results vary significantly based on prompt specificity and clarity
  • Limited ability to match highly specific brand guidelines automatically
  • Figma plugin dependency means locked into one design tool
